Description
Oceanos is a game of underwater exploration where 2 to 5 players pilot their own submarines to spot the most underwater species and discover the largest coral reef. With easy-to-learn rules, players can quickly dive into the action, sending scuba-divers after forgotten treasures and collecting precious crystals to upgrade their ship. The game is designed by Antoine Bauza and offers a unique take on card drafting, set collection, and simultaneous action selection. As players navigate the ocean, they'll need to balance their upgrades and actions to outscore their opponents. With multiple ways to score points and upgrade their submarines, the game offers several paths to victory. The quick 30 to 45 minute playtime makes it a great option for families or casual gamers, and the beautiful depiction of marine life adds to the game's charm. Published in 2016, Oceanos is a fun and engaging game that's perfect for anyone looking for a lighthearted underwater adventure.
